Many of Mill Springs' graduates go on to achieve great things. Some examples of this include:
- Amy Weaver 2005: Got married in August of 2010. Congratulations.
- Drew Carson 2008: He finished up his first year at SCAD on the Dean's list for the full year and had straight A's this past quarter. He has declared his major in Production Design, with a minor in Arts Administration. Drew was selected to design a show for a grad student, which is unheard of for a freshman. From what we hear there is a pecking order at SCAD so Drew is hoping to work his way up quickly in his sophomore year so that by his junior year, he can work on the 'big' shows. We'll keep our fingers crossed but we here at MSA have every confidence in Drew and his abilities.
- Michael Goodroe 2006: Attends the University of West Georgia, just received notice in May that he has made the Dean's List. Students must achieve a minimum GPA of 3.5 in order to receive this distinction.
- Megan Feeley 2005: She graduated in May 2009 from Reinhardt College with a degree in fine arts/digital photography. In 2008, Megan was named as the top art student in the department of Art & Humanities at Reinhardt. Megan plans to continue her study of fine arts in graduate school and was invited back to address the Class of 2009, as well as several thousand attendees at Reinhardt's graduation ceremonies where she spoke about the lasting rewards of her MSA and college experiences.
- Bennett Gaddes 2005: He graduated Cum Laude from Reinhardt College in 2009. In addition to wearing an honor cord for his Cum Laude status. Bennett also wore cords for his membership in Phi Alpha Theta and one for excellence achieved in history. Earlier in the spring he and three other Reinhardt Seniors were honored in a small formal ceremony and reception to recognize their induction into Phi Alpha Theta. Phi Alpha Theta is a professional society whose mission is to promote the study of history through the encouragement of research, good teaching, publication and the exchange of learning and ideas among historians.
- Chas MacNeill 2005: In 2009 he graduated Summa Cum Laude from Eckerd College with a 3.9 GPA. Chas, who speaks fluent Chinese, has plans to move to China in the near future.
- Brad Hopkins 2003: He graduated from Berry College in Rome, GA in 2007. He is currently working on his masters in finance at Georgia State University.
